Wanneroo Welcomes Funding for Coastal Protection

The City of Wanneroo has welcomed the announcement of $300,000 of State Government funding for coastal protection in Quinns Rocks in 2016/17.

Last week, the State Government announced it would contribute $750,295 to local authorities for projects aimed at protecting the Western Australian coastline, with Wanneroo receiving the largest allocation.

City of Wanneroo Mayor Tracey Roberts said that the funding would complement the work the City was already doing in this area but much more government funding was required given how much money the City has already spent.

Coastal management is a significant issue for the City of Wanneroo and we have several plans and projects in place to make sure our coastline is well maintained,” she said.

Since 2000, the City has spent $5.6 million from its own resources on the management of coastal erosion issues at Quinns Beach, including $3.4 million over the last three years.”

“The City is prioritizing this issue and we have made huge investments to address erosion. We hope the State Government will match our commitment to combat the problem.”

The $300,000 from the State Government will contribute to early works associated with the implementation of the preferred long term coastal management option for the Quinns Rocks coastline.
